数据库unknown类型是什么意思

不及物动词 其他 13

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库中的"unknown"类型是指在某个字段中的值未知或缺失的情况。在数据库中,每个字段都有一个特定的数据类型,用于定义该字段可以存储的数据的种类。通常情况下,数据库字段的数据类型可以是数值型、字符型、日期型等。然而,在某些情况下,某个字段的值可能是未知的或者缺失的,这时可以将该字段的数据类型设置为"unknown"。

    以下是关于"unknown"类型的一些重要信息:

    1. 数据缺失:在某些情况下,由于数据采集或处理的原因,某个字段的值可能无法获取或者丢失了。例如,在某个用户注册表中,可能会出现没有填写邮箱地址的情况,这时可以将邮箱字段的数据类型设置为"unknown",表示该字段的值是未知的或者缺失的。

    2. 数据不确定性:在某些情况下,某个字段的值可能是不确定的。例如,在某个销售记录中,可能有些产品的价格未知或者变动频繁,这时可以将价格字段的数据类型设置为"unknown",以表示该字段的值是不确定的。

    3. 数据分析:在进行数据分析或者统计时,如果某个字段的值是未知的或者缺失的,可以将该字段的数据类型设置为"unknown",以便在计算或者分析过程中对这些值进行特殊处理。

    4. 数据完整性:在数据库设计中,可以通过设置字段的约束条件来确保数据的完整性。对于某些字段,如果其值是必需的但是未知的,可以将该字段的数据类型设置为"unknown",并添加相应的约束条件,以确保在插入或更新数据时必须提供该字段的值。

    5. 查询和过滤:在进行数据库查询或者过滤时,如果需要排除或者特别处理某些未知或者缺失的值,可以根据字段的数据类型为"unknown"进行相应的操作。

    总之,"unknown"类型在数据库中用于表示某个字段的值是未知的或者缺失的情况。通过设置该字段的数据类型为"unknown",可以在数据处理、分析和查询等方面进行特殊处理。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,Unknown类型通常指的是未知或未定义的数据类型。这意味着数据库无法确定该列中的数据类型或者数据库不支持该数据类型。

    当数据库遇到无法识别的数据类型时,通常会将该数据类型标记为Unknown。这种情况可能发生在以下几种情况下:

    1. 数据库中的某个列没有明确指定数据类型。
    2. 数据库表中的某个列的数据类型与数据库支持的数据类型不匹配。
    3. 数据库引擎无法识别某个列中的数据类型。

    对于未知数据类型的列,数据库通常会采取一些默认的处理方式。例如,数据库可能会将该列的数据类型设置为一个通用的数据类型,如字符串类型(VARCHAR)或者文本类型(TEXT)。这样可以确保数据能够被存储,但可能会导致一些数据的精确性和完整性的损失。

    为了避免出现Unknown类型的数据,建议在设计数据库时,明确指定每个列的数据类型,并确保与数据库支持的数据类型相匹配。同时,对于从外部数据源导入的数据,应该进行数据类型的验证和转换,以保证数据的准确性和一致性。

    总之,Unknown类型在数据库中表示未知或未定义的数据类型,需要注意在数据库设计和数据导入过程中避免出现该类型的数据。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库中的unknown类型是指在数据表中某一列的数据类型未知或未确定的情况。当创建数据表时,如果没有明确指定某一列的数据类型,或者在插入数据时没有指定某一列的具体值,那么该列的数据类型就会被默认为unknown类型。

    在数据库中,unknown类型的列可以存储任意类型的数据,包括数字、字符串、日期等。因为数据库无法确定该列的具体数据类型,所以在进行查询、排序、计算等操作时,可能会产生一些问题。

    为了避免数据不一致性和操作错误,通常在设计数据库时应尽量避免使用unknown类型。应该明确指定每一列的数据类型,以确保数据的准确性和一致性。

    如果在数据库中存在unknown类型的列,可以通过以下方法来处理:

    1. 修改表结构:通过修改表结构,明确指定该列的数据类型。可以根据实际需求选择合适的数据类型,如整数型、字符型、日期型等。

    2. 更新数据:如果该列的数据已经存在,可以通过更新操作来给该列的数据赋予具体的值。根据数据的实际情况,选择合适的值进行更新。

    3. 数据转换:如果无法确定该列的具体数据类型,可以将该列的数据导出到其他工具进行处理。通过其他工具,可以对数据进行分析、转换、清洗等操作,以便确定数据的具体类型。

    4. 数据迁移:如果无法确定该列的具体数据类型,并且无法进行数据转换,可以考虑将数据迁移到一个新的数据库中。在新的数据库中,可以重新设计表结构,明确指定每一列的数据类型。

    无论采取何种方法,处理unknown类型的列都需要谨慎操作,并保证数据的完整性和一致性。在处理过程中,应该充分考虑数据的实际情况和需求,选择合适的解决方案。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部